Visual Studio 版本、C# 版本和.NET 版本的一个对应关系
2020-12-13 16:39
标签:style blog http io ar os sp for on 节选自http://learninghard.blog.51cto.com/6146675/1197401 之所以在这里分享这个对应关系,是因为在C#基础知识系列的文章发布之后,有些初学者对.NET版本和C#语言特性之间的对应关系有点不清楚,有时候会弄混淆了。 并且通过这个对应关系,也可以帮助大家对C#和.NET 类库有个全面的把控,可以帮助大家理清楚C#和.NET 类库中各个知识点,使他们可以对号入坐。具体他们的之间对应关系见下表: C# 版本 .NET Framework版本 Visual Studio版本 发布日期 特性 C# 1.0 .NET Framework 1.0 Visual Studio .NET 2002 2002.1 委托 事件 APM C# 1.1 .NET Framework 1.1 Visual Studio .NET 2003 2003.4 C# 2.0 .NET Framework 2.0 Visual Studio 2005(开始命名为Visual Studio) 2005.11 泛型 匿名方法 迭代器 可空类型 C# 3.0 .NET Framework 3.0 .NET Framework 3.5 Visual Studio 2008 2007.11 隐式类型的部变量 对象集合初始化 自动实现属性 匿名类型 扩展方法 查询表达式 Lambda表达式 表达式树 分部类和方法 Linq C# 4.0 .NET Framework 4.0 Visual Studio 2010 2010.4 动态绑定 命名和可选参数 泛型的协变和逆变 互操作性 C# 5.0 .NET Framework 4.5 Visual Studio 2012 2012.8 异步和等待(async和await) 调用方信息(Caller Information) Visual Studio 版本、C# 版本和.NET 版本的一个对应关系 标签:style blog http io ar os sp for on 原文地址:http://www.cnblogs.com/chucklu/p/4085814.html
文章标题:Visual Studio 版本、C# 版本和.NET 版本的一个对应关系
文章链接:http://soscw.com/essay/36383.html